Chapter 142: Surging Luck Value, Li Zhu Grotto-Heaven!

Jiang Yuan's Spirit Sea was rapidly expanding within his body.

From its original size of thirteen zhang, it quickly expanded and grew to fourteen zhang in the blink of an eye.

The waves surged and crashed against the outer wall of this small world.

The area of the Spirit Sea also expanded continuously with each crash.

Fifteen zhang, fifteen zhang fifty-six zhang.

As time passed, the expansion speed gradually slowed down.

Jiang Yuan also knew that he was about to break through.

After a long time, it finally stopped at a size of sixteen zhang six.

Jiang Yuan felt that the capacity within his body had nearly doubled, and he couldn't help but show a look of joy.

However, he realized that breaking through from the third to the fourth realm would require double the resources, which gave him a headache.

He still had over ten thousand pieces of low-grade spirit stones left.

It was far from enough, so it seemed that he could only refine the half of the spirit vein jade marrow.

Then he slowly opened his eyes.

He opened his own panel and took a look.

[Name]: Jiang Yuan

[Realm]: Spirit Sea Realm, Third Level

[Innate Luck]: Ancient Dual Pupils (Gold), Boundless Longevity (Purple), Emperor's Bloodline (Purple), Peerless Wisdom (Purple), Dragon Elephant Tyrant Body (Purple), Five Elements Spirit Body (Blue), Soul Condensation (Blue), Divine Marksman (Blue)

[Luck Power]: 836 strands

[Luck Seed]: Intermediate Luck Seed

He saw Lu Qingshan in the front yard.

He took another look at Shu Xiaoxiao, who was still practicing, and couldn't help but be amazed.

This little girl could actually practice without rest for seven days. In terms of being abnormal, she was no less than me!

Then he quietly left his small courtyard and came to the front yard.

"Greetings, Sect Master!" Jiang Yuan cupped his hands in salute.

"No need for formalities!" Lu Qingshan smiled and then looked Jiang Yuan up and down.

"I didn't expect you to be so abnormal, breaking through another realm in just seven days."

"If you had enough resources, I'm afraid you could break through to the Spirit Sea Realm in one or two years."

Jiang Yuan sighed softly, "But even so, it will still take one or two years to break through, provided that there are enough resources. Unfortunately, there are not enough resources!"

Thinking of this, Jiang Yuan felt a headache.

Don't be fooled by the fact that he only needed over thirty thousand spirit stones to break through to the third level of the Spirit Sea Realm.

But if you look at the requirements of the Spirit Sea Realm, the resources needed for each breakthrough are doubled.

As a result, breaking through from the eighth to the ninth level of the Spirit Sea Realm would require an enormous amount of resources.

He quickly calculated that he would need over two million low-grade spirit stones, which would deplete the savings of a sect.

This might be the downside of reaching the ninth level of the Spirit Sea Realm at an early stage. It had a naturally profound foundation, and the resources needed for subsequent breakthroughs naturally increased.

However, the benefits it brought were also significant, with the total amount of spiritual power several times higher than that of cultivators at the same realm.

The most crucial point was that the foundation was deeper, allowing for a further future.

But it came back to the same problem: the resources needed were astronomical.

Seeing Jiang Yuan's worried expression, Lu Qingshan then said lightly, "This is not too big of a problem!"

Jiang Yuan's eyes lit up, and he looked at him, asking, "Sect Master, do you have a solution?"

Lu Qingshan smiled faintly, "That vein of spirit stones has already secured thirty percent of the future profit distribution for you!"

"Thank you, Grand Sect Master!" Jiang Yuan happily bowed.

"No need to thank me, this is what you deserve," replied the Grand Sect Master.

Jiang Yuan continued, "Grand Sect Master, I wonder how much the daily output of this spiritual stone vein is?"

"Based on the inference from the previous three spiritual stone veins, the annual output is approximately around 200,000," replied the Grand Sect Master.

"Why is the output so low?" Jiang Yuan asked, expressing the doubt that had been in his mind for a long time.

"There are two reasons," explained Lu Qingshan.

"The first reason is for sustainable mining. It is necessary to ensure that the spiritual energy concentration of the spiritual stone vein is sufficient in order to continuously generate spiritual stones through Spirit Gathering Qi, and to ensure that the reserves of spiritual stones never run out. Otherwise, excessive mining may cause the entire vein to lose its regenerative ability in a few decades."

"The second reason is that the spiritual stones are fragile and cannot be mined with force. Once the surface is damaged, the internal spiritual energy will be lost."

"These two reasons combined result in a low annual output."

After listening to Lu Qingshan's explanation, Jiang Yuan fell into contemplation.

Allocating thirty percent of the output to him was indeed generous.

But for him, it was limited. With only sixty thousand spiritual stones per year, he immediately felt a headache when he thought about the resources he needed for his breakthrough.

Relying solely on the output of this spiritual stone vein, it would take several decades for him to have enough to break through to the Spirit Sea Realm.

This speed was normal for others.

It should be noted that in the current Qianyuan Kingdom, there were very few people under the age of fifty who could break through to the Spirit Sea Realm.

Even those ranked on the Heavenly Rankings, only a few had communicated with the Heavenly Bridge before the age of fifty and achieved the Divine Bridge Realm.

A thought flashed through Jiang Yuan's mind.

Then he looked at Lu Qingshan and said, "Grand Sect Master, what do you think of this?"

"Advance me twenty years' worth of spiritual stone quota, and I will return thirty percent of the output of this spiritual stone vein to the sect. What do you think of this?"

Upon hearing Jiang Yuan's words, Lu Qingshan was momentarily stunned.

"Are you lacking cultivation resources?" he asked.

Jiang Yuan nodded, "Yes, I am. I want to achieve the Divine Bridge Realm as soon as possible, so I am lacking resources."

"If I have enough resources, I am confident that I can achieve the Spirit Sea Realm in one or two years."

Lu Qingshan fell into silence. After a while, he slowly said, "Even if I intervene, I won't be able to secure a twenty-year advance for you."

"Nowadays, there is a sense of an impending storm between the Qianyuan Royal Family and the major sects."

"Someone even proposed that it would be better to mine the spiritual stone vein to the point of destruction rather than leaving it to the Qianyuan Royal Family in case of accidents."

"So, twenty years is not something anyone would agree to, and we can't produce that many spiritual stones now! It might have been possible in previous years!"

Jiang Yuan said, "Then, Grand Sect Master, how many years do you estimate can be advanced, and how many of the other peak masters would agree?"

Lu Qingshan pondered for a moment, then slowly said, "Ten to fifteen years should be possible, with a minimum of ten years and a maximum of fifteen years."

Jiang Yuan immediately bowed and said, "Then please, Grand Sect Master, take care of this matter for me. I am willing to return thirty percent of the quota to the sect in exchange for ten to fifteen years of spiritual stone allocation."

"Good!" Lu Qingshan nodded, then added, "Tomorrow, I will gather all the peak masters. At that time, I will ask them to contribute to buying this allocation. I believe there should be no problem."

"Thank you, Grand Sect Master!" Jiang Yuan bowed.

Lu Qingshan continued, "If you want to break through to the Spirit Sea Realm quickly, there is one place you must go."

Jiang Yuan curiously asked, "Where?"

"The Liju Grotto-Heaven."

"What is that place?" Jiang Yuan looked puzzled.

"It is a true Grotto-Heaven world, a complete Grotto-Heaven world! Haven't you heard of it?" Lu Qingshan shook his head.

"Please enlighten me, Grand Sect Master!" Jiang Yuan said.

Lu Qingshan then explained, "The Liju Grotto-Heaven is a Grotto-Heaven world left behind by a fallen Demon King. There was once a Dragon King who accidentally died within the borders of the Qianyuan Kingdom, and the Dragon Clan, which contains the bloodline of true dragons, has great difficulty giving birth to offspring. So, in his rage, he caused a surge of seawater to flood into the Qianyuan Kingdom, annihilating the people of several provinces as a burial for his deceased offspring."

"He even declared that the entire Qianyuan Kingdom should be buried with his child."

Jiang Yuan was immediately puzzled, "Wasn't the Qianyuan Kingdom's ruler his opponent?"

Lu Qingshan couldn't help but chuckle.

"You don't know how powerful the Demon King is, and he is also the Dragon King. Even if the Lord of the country and all the people of the Qianyuan Kingdom join forces, they are nothing more than ants marching to their deaths!"

"What happened later? How did he fall despite being so powerful?" Jiang Yuan asked, still puzzled.

"Because!" Lu Qingshan looked at the eastern sky. "Because a sage broke through the boundaries and with a single finger caused his downfall. Afterwards, he even drove away a demon saint who wanted to come ashore!"

"What level is a sage?" Jiang Yuan asked.

Lu Qingshan shook his head. "I can't explain it. They are beings who have condensed the Dao and represent the heritage of the human race."

"There is a saying that has been widely circulated: 'Under the sage, all are ants.'"

"Without attaining the Dao and becoming a sage, no matter how powerful one is, they are no different from ants in front of a sage!"

"They represent the rules and the Great Dao, embodying the heavenly constitution. Their words are law!"

"The Grotto-Heaven was also formed by that sage, using a great Divine Ability to solidify it."

"Before leaving, he left a message: the Grotto-Heaven will remain here as a trial ground for young geniuses. It opens every ten years, and only those under fifty years old can enter."

"So, from then on, only those under fifty years old can enter this Grotto-Heaven. No one can break the rules he established. That is the rule spoken by the sage."

Hearing Lu Qingshan's words, Jiang Yuan let out a sigh and couldn't help but feel a sense of longing.

Then he asked, "Master, why does this Grotto-Heaven allow me to quickly break through the Spirit Sea Realm?"

Lu Qingshan smiled faintly. "Because the Grotto-Heaven is full of countless opportunities and treasures. In the Qianyuan Kingdom, it is difficult to find such treasures, but it's different in the Grotto-Heaven. There is no shortage of millennium spirit medicines!"

"Once you enter, as long as you find some opportunities, it will definitely help you quickly accumulate your Spirit Sea."

"It is also because of the requirements of the Grotto-Heaven that the Heavenly Rankings came into existence, and only geniuses under fifty years old can ascend to it."

Jiang Yuan listened and couldn't help but feel delighted.

He remembered another effect of his panel, which allowed him to consume Luck power to discover opportunities.

It had been a long time since he had discovered any so-called opportunities.

The reason for this was that there were no opportunities around him, making it impossible for him to explore.

But entering the Grotto-Heaven was different. There were countless opportunities inside, making it a true treasure trove for him!

He became interested and felt that he must go to this place.

But before that, he needed to further improve his strength. In the Qianyuan Kingdom, those under fifty years old were only at the Divine Bridge Realm. He had no qualifications to fight against them.

The gap in cultivation realms was too great!

Lu Qingshan looked at Jiang Yuan's expression and knew that he was full of interest.

He said, "The Grotto-Heaven will open in nine months, and the demon race will also come to participate. You should quickly improve your strength. If everything goes well tomorrow, I will provide you with cultivation resources!"

Jiang Yuan nodded. "Okay!"

After Lu Qingshan left, Jiang Yuan turned his head and glanced at Shu Xiaoxiao, who was still cultivating.

Then he walked out of the mansion alone.

After a while, Jiang Yuan arrived at the Qingyun Hall.

This was where Lu Qingshan lived and where his direct disciples resided.

Gu Mo also lived here. Jiang Yuan went to Gu Mo's mansion and chatted with him, learning that his recent cultivation had been smooth.

He had also completed a sect mission before, killing a cultivator who practiced evil techniques and had slaughtered several villages. These villages were within the territory of the Taixuan Sect.

Jiang Yuan also collected some Luck power from him.

He now had a total of 858 strands of Luck power.

Seeing that he was still halfway from his goal, Jiang Yuan planned to gather Luck power from the Taixuan Sect according to his previous plan.

He would guide those who had gone astray, including senior and junior brothers and sisters, helping them successfully tap into their potential. This would undoubtedly cause his Luck to surge.

By upgrading his Luck, he could enhance his talent.

This point is more important than secluding oneself for a few days.

If he can break through 2000 strands of Luck Power in one go, and then transform a blue Innate Luck into purple.

In this way, his talent will definitely improve a lot.

On this day.

Tianzhu Peak.

Jiang Yuan wandered around Tianzhu Peak and found a disciple who had taken the wrong path. Because of his guidance, that person made up his mind to cultivate a gold attribute technique.

As a result, Jiang Yuan gained 63 strands of Luck Power.

He looked at the increasing Luck Power on his panel, which reached 921 strands, and couldn't help but shake his head.

Too slow, this efficiency is too low.

Moreover, most disciples are either secluding themselves for cultivation or going out for experience.

And most of them have not deviated from the right path.

For those with the five elements constitutions, most of them have entered the correct path.

After pondering for a long time, he shook his head.

Forget it, with this effort, it's better to continue practicing.

Currently, the core growth still comes from the geniuses with purple Luck Power.

Geniuses with purple Luck Power can condense one strand of Luck Power every day. Depending on their cultivation, they can accumulate anywhere from a dozen strands to over fifty strands.

On the other hand, those with gold Luck Power can gather ten strands of Luck Power in a day.

But at present, he found that he and Shu Xiaoxiao both have gold-level Innate Luck.

Just at this moment.

A man approached, exuding a golden aura.

This person is Xu Bai, another true disciple of Lu Qingshan.

Jiang Yuan had been to Qingyun Palace several times and had never seen him before. Unexpectedly, he met him on a mountain path today.

With a thought, Jiang Yuan absorbed the golden aura from him.

The Luck Power on the panel increased again, reaching 957 strands.

Seeing the growing number, Jiang Yuan was instantly satisfied.

It has to be like this!

At this time, Xu Bai walked over with a smile on his face. "Greetings, Brother Jiang. I didn't expect to meet you here today."

Jiang Yuan smiled. "I didn't expect to meet Brother Xu here either. Did you just come back from outside?"

"Yes!" Xu Bai nodded slightly, then said, "I went to the mortal world for a while and fulfilled my last filial duty."

At this point, a hint of sadness flashed in his eyes, and he sighed deeply.

"From now on, I am truly free from attachments in the mortal world! The ones I have let down the most are actually my parents!"

"I didn't pass on the family lineage to them, nor did I let them enjoy the joy of family."

"I even failed to fulfill the basic duty of taking care of them in their old age!"

He couldn't help but bitterly smile. "As their son, I have brought them nothing but disappointment!"

Jiang Yuan didn't know how to comfort him and walked over to pat his shoulder. "Take care!"

Looking at Jiang Yuan, Xu Bai said, "It feels better to say it out loud. I'll go report to Master first, and we can chat later when we have time!"

"Alright!"

Jiang Yuan nodded and watched him disappear into the small path.

Thinking of what he had just said, Jiang Yuan sighed as he looked at the sky above his head.

"You can still fulfill your duty, but I can't even do that! I wonder how they are doing on the other side of the starry sky!"

He shook his head, dispelling the distractions in his mind, and walked slowly towards his mansion.
